Mar 07, 2010· Best Answer: This gold separation in panning for gold is based on golds high density (ie heavy weight) Gold is heavier than whatever else you're gonna find in the grave After some water is added to help reduce friction and separate everything apart, the gold settles to the bottom and is the last thing left in the pan after everything else is removed.

Panning, in mining, simple method of separating particles of greater specific gravity (especially gold) from soil or gravels by washing in a pan with water Panning is one of the principal techniques of the individual prospector for recovering gold and diamonds in placer (alluvial) deposits The.
